1、Reducing Nitrogen Fertilizer with Pea Cultivation

Most pea plants flourish in symbiotic relationship with rhizobia, bacteria that live in nodules in the legumes’ roots. Rhizobia shelter in the nodules and get food (nutrients) from the pea plant – and in return, they transform inert atmospheric nitrogen gas found in the soil into a form of nitrogen that the peas can use.

Managing Nitrogen With Field Peas in Your No

I’ve been told field peas will produce a pound to a pound and a half of nitrogen for every bushel of field peas they produce per acre. A 30-bushel-per-acre field pea crop could be expected to produce from 30-45 pounds of N per acre. Field peas are one of the best N producers in the legume family.

Do peas increase nitrogen in soil?

Yes, peas, like other legumes, significantly increase the amount of usable nitrogen in the soil through a specialized biological process called nitrogen fixation, carried out by symbiotic bacteria in their root nodules.

Pea Fertility Requirements

With pea and nitrogen, it’s possible to have too much of a good thing. Excess N fertilizer will reduce the amount of N fixed by a pea crop, delay crop maturity, increase disease levels and reduce standability.
